Before you commit to Malaga, check out what the water looks like from the gazebo. I've made one dive there and attempted to make multiple other dives....each time, the water has been like chocolate milk (i.e. can't see your buddy unless they're kicking you in the face....even good lights would not cut through the stuff!). I hear it's a great site when the visibility is good, but I've never seen the water look even decent.

If the water looks bad, you can hit Vet's....not the most interesting site sometimes, but can be great if you slow down and look carefully.

I see high tide is about +5 feet at about 7am....White Point would probably be doable (the higher the tide the better....but the surf looks like it should be non-existent, which will definitely help), but I'd recommend trying to get out closer to 9am, rather than meeting or getting in at 9am.

Those are the only PV locations that I really know of (other than OML which will not be open to the public for a little bit).
